Chapter 11: First Alchemy
Originally, Yang Jue planned to start studying alchemy in Nuremberg, but due to some unexpected events later on, Yang Jue and his family were forced to move to the imperial capital, so Yang Jue's alchemy plan was stillborn.
Since he decided to continue studying alchemy, Yang Jue did not return home directly after school in the afternoon, but instead took his sister Hei Yue to a small magical market. First, they found a bank where they could deposit and withdraw money, and withdrew 100 gold coins from the magic crystal card given by Solara. Then, they used this money to buy a large number of alchemy items. In addition, as he had thought before in Newamburg, Yang Jue still planned to start learning alchemy from the lowest-level magical potion - Primary Healing Potion.
Having had a purchasing experience, Yang Jue was very familiar with the process and quickly bought all the necessary materials for making primary treatment potions, such as silverleaf grass, hundred-mile fragrance, and containers like bottles or jars.
"Brother, what are we buying these strange things for?" Hei Yue was quite perplexed.
"Haha! Don't underestimate these things! I make a living from them!" Yang Jue said with an air of mystery.
Back home. After dinner with his parents, Yang Jue sneaked into the basement, planning to start learning alchemy immediately. His sister Hei Yue followed him out of curiosity.
"Yang Jue brother, what are we going to do after all?" Seeing Yang Jue start arranging those peculiarly shaped bottles and small jars, Hei Yue couldn't help but ask.
"Trying out alchemy, brewing a basic healing potion." Yang Jue replied.
"What is this primary treatment potion?" Hei Yue asked again.
"A magical potion. After successful preparation, it can be exchanged for money." Yang Jue smiled and explained.
"Really?!" Hei Yue was clearly very interested in this sort of thing.
Talk is cheap, action speaks louder. At this moment, Yang Jue immediately began experimenting on how to mix the primary treatment potion.
This task, saying it's not difficult is not easy. When mixing medicinal water, apart from mastering the quantity of each material, process control is key. After all, various chemical agents mixed together must have some reaction. Once this process loses control, the result will certainly be a failure.
In fact, the entire process of preparing the medicine requires extremely strong spiritual energy to control, otherwise it would be difficult to succeed. And in this aspect, Yang Jue is particularly skilled.
In addition, the preparation of potions also requires the consumption of a certain amount of magical energy. In other words, Yang Jue not only needs to control the reaction process of the potion but also needs to spend mental strength to gather magical energy, and in places where magical energy is scarce, this step becomes extremely mentally taxing.
Fortunately, Yang Jue still had a treasure, which was the ancestral jade stone that brought him across to this world.
This jade stone was not a peculiar object in the world where Yang Jue originally resided, but after crossing over to this world, Yang Jue discovered that it had an extremely practical function - it could automatically help its wearer collect magical energy.
"Automatically collect magical energy!" If one is well-versed in magic, they would know just how precious a function this is. After all, when a magician wants to cast any spell, the first thing they need to do is find a way to gather magical energy. Only with magical energy can spells be cast. And for most magicians, gathering magical energy mainly relies on mental strength.
Imagine having a treasure that can continuously provide magical energy by your side. When the energy is depleted, it can automatically recharge, making it effortless to cast magic. Yang Jue's jade stone can be said to be a heaven-defying object! If people were to find out, who knows how many envious magicians would frantically try to snatch it away.
In fact, Yang Jue was able to cast third-level magic at the age of six, thanks to the help of Jade Stone in gathering magical energy. Otherwise, even if Yang Jue's magical talent was strong, it would be impossible to collect enough energy to cast a third-level spell in a short period of time, let alone instantly casting a third-level spell.
This is Yang Jue's biggest secret. Normally, he wears jade close to his body and never easily shows it to others.
With the help of Yu Shi in collecting magical energy and having a strong spiritual force to control the preparation process, Yang Jue's production of magic medicine was no longer so difficult. Thus, within about an hour or so, Yang Jue successfully experimented with the first bottle of "Primary Healing Potion".
Having gained experience in making the first bottle of primary treatment potion, it's no longer a difficult task to make the second and third bottles.
So, after a night's work, Yang Jue produced 100 bottles of primary treatment potion. If sold at the market price of 5 copper per bottle, these 100 bottles of treatment potion could be sold for 500 copper, which is equivalent to 5 silver, just breaking even. After all, it was his first time refining gold, and he would naturally waste a lot of materials during experimentation. Being able to break even wasn't bad either.
The question is whether the 100 bottles of primary treatment potion made by Yang Jue for the first time have reached market standards and can be sold for 5 coppers per bottle.
The next day, at noon during the school break, Yang Jue quietly slipped out of school and brought 100 bottles of medicine in a box to that small magic market he went to yesterday.
Found a store that specializes in selling magical potions, at the door to size up this small pharmacy called "Magic Medicine Hall", hesitated for a moment, Yang Jue still walked into the store.
In the small shop, there was a long counter, and the boss, wearing a pair of deep-seated myopia glasses, sat behind the counter and dozed off. Behind him, there was a row of tall shelves, on which all kinds of magical potions were placed, and Yang Jue discovered that among them was a primary treatment potion.
"Boss..." Yang Jue knocked on the counter.
"Ah...... what's up, little friend?" The boss suddenly woke up and looked around, only to find a six-year-old kid with a small build standing in front of the counter.
"Boss, I'd like to ask if you buy magic potions here?" Yang Jue asked.
"Ah, what's wrong? Are you here to supply goods?" The boss asked jokingly.
"Yes, boss! Would you mind helping me appraise the quality of these potions?" Yang Jue placed the potions he had refined on the counter. Due to the high counter, he had to stand on tiptoes to do so.
The boss looked at him with a suspicious gaze, then opened the box and casually picked up one of the bottles of medicine, took a glance, and asked: "Primary treatment potion. Who brewed it? Was it your dad?"
"How did you know, boss? It's true, these medicines were made by my father. After he finished making them, he asked me to sell them." At this moment, Yang Jue looked like a naive and innocent child, harmless, and if he was lying, it's likely that no one would suspect him.
"Hey, you're still so young, it's a pity. Is your father willing to let you come out and sell things? Where is your father? Why didn't he come himself?" the boss asked.
"My dad is busy with something. He said 'children from poor families should be independent early', I'm not young anymore, it's time for me to go out and gain some experience." Yang Jue said with a smile.
"No wonder. Alright, let me appraise the quality of these potions first, and then decide on a purchase price." With that, the boss began to appraise the low-level healing potions that Yang Jue had brought over.
He first used a dropper to take out some medicine, put it in a bright place to carefully observe the color, then put it under his nose to smell the scent, and finally even tasted it with his tongue.
"Hmm, the quality of this primary treatment potion is really good! It's already reached a high standard! Much better than what we had in stock before!" The boss kept praising.
For such an evaluation, Yang Jue felt very surprised. "My first attempt at alchemy would actually have such a good level? Looking at this, a genius alchemist is about to be born?" Yang Jue thought excitedly.
"Alright kiddo, I'll take all of these potions! And I'll give you 7 copper for them. By the way, this is the highest price I've ever offered for a basic healing potion - usually I only pay 5 copper per bottle. Also, when you go back, tell your dad that I'm really hoping to establish a long-term partnership with him. As long as he keeps brewing high-quality potions, I'll be happy to buy them from him at 20% above market price, no matter what kind they are. Oh, and what's your dad's name?" the boss asked.
"My dad is just a relatively unknown junior magician. Nobody knows his name even if I say it out loud." Yang Jue laughed and said.
"Oh, then please give this card to your father. My name and the address of my small shop are written on it. Go back and tell him that I welcome him to visit my small shop at any time." Seeing Yang Jue deliberately hiding something, the boss showed understanding, after all, some alchemists in order to protect themselves, generally acted very low-key, so he didn't ask further questions.
Yang Jue took over the card and saw that there was a name written on it called "Chad".
"Okay, Uncle Chad. I'll definitely tell my dad."
"Right, 100 bottles of basic healing potion, each bottle costs 7 copper, that's a total of 700 copper, which is equivalent to 7 silver. Here are the 7 silver coins, take them." Chad handed over the 7 silver coins to Yang Jue.
"Thank you, uncle."
Originally thought that as long as it was possible to break even, it would be good enough, but unexpectedly the result turned out better than expected and actually earned 200 copper.
200 copper! Although it's a small amount, the significance is extraordinary. This means that Yang Jue has successfully entered the ranks of alchemists and can now make a living with his own abilities.
